Transaction ede7667d659741edc01b0d39f02e961ba3aeb1de5229bec1517f429f2d632c44
1 Input
1 Output
-
ede7667d659741edc01b0d39f02e961ba3aeb1de5229bec1517f429f2d632c44:0
- value
- 2817091
- script pubkey
- OP_0 OP_PUSHBYTES_20 204fc38255260e2194cab7c03eba6686978ba924
- address
- bc1qyp8u8qj4yc8zr9x2klqrawnxs6tch2fy22s76n